Skip to content

Commit e9ca43f

Browse files
committed
Fix some MS SQL syntaxes in tests
1 parent 13c8830 commit e9ca43f

File tree

2 files changed

+12
-4
lines changed

2 files changed

+12
-4
lines changed

scalasql/test/src/operations/DbBlobOpsTests.scala

Lines changed: 6 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-26,7 +26,7 @@ trait ExprBlobOpsTests extends ScalaSqlSuite {
2626

2727
test("length") - checker(
2828
query = Expr(Bytes("hello")).length,
29-
sql = "SELECT LENGTH(?) AS res",
29+
sqls = Seq("SELECT LENGTH(?) AS res", "SELECT LEN(?) AS res"),
3030
value = 5
3131
)
3232

@@ -39,7 +39,11 @@ trait ExprBlobOpsTests extends ScalaSqlSuite {
3939

4040
test("position") - checker(
4141
query = Expr(Bytes("hello")).indexOf(Bytes("ll")),
42-
sqls = Seq("SELECT POSITION(? IN ?) AS res", "SELECT INSTR(?, ?) AS res"),
42+
sqls = Seq(
43+
"SELECT POSITION(? IN ?) AS res",
44+
"SELECT INSTR(?, ?) AS res",
45+
"SELECT CHARINDEX(?, ?) AS res"
46+
),
4347
value = 3
4448
)
4549
// Not supported by postgres

scalasql/test/src/operations/DbStringOpsTests.scala

Lines changed: 6 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-26,7 +26,7 @@ trait ExprStringOpsTests extends ScalaSqlSuite {
2626

2727
test("length") - checker(
2828
query = Expr("hello").length,
29-
sql = "SELECT LENGTH(?) AS res",
29+
sqls = Seq("SELECT LENGTH(?) AS res", "SELECT LEN(?) AS res"),
3030
value = 5
3131
)
3232

@@ -39,7 +39,11 @@ trait ExprStringOpsTests extends ScalaSqlSuite {
3939

4040
test("position") - checker(
4141
query = Expr("hello").indexOf("ll"),
42-
sqls = Seq("SELECT POSITION(? IN ?) AS res", "SELECT INSTR(?, ?) AS res"),
42+
sqls = Seq(
43+
"SELECT POSITION(? IN ?) AS res",
44+
"SELECT INSTR(?, ?) AS res",
45+
"SELECT CHARINDEX(?, ?) AS res"
46+
),
4347
value = 3
4448
)
4549

0 commit comments

Comments
 (0)